The Way of Valor Podcast equips Christian parents to raise children who follow Jesus, develop resilient character, and walk confidently in their God given purpose. In a world shaping children through fear, distraction, and confusion, many parents are asking: How do I raise resilient kids in an anxious world? How do I disciple my children beyond behavior management? How do I help my child develop grit, confidence, and faith that lasts? How do I parent with conviction without losing connection?
